About the charity : jole rider jole rider
Many students in Africa have to walk more than 10 miles every day, in searing heat, to reach their nearest school. They arrive late, exhausted and unable to concentrate. jole rider sends bicycles to African schools and provides repair workshops, tools and bike maintenance training for students.

The 2008 shenanigan of Slightly Clive Racing, in conjunction with Practical Classics magazine.

Our mission: To introduce tweed, wicker and gingham to places hitherto underexposed to stuff-upper-lip tweeness - gin and tonics on the shore of the Caspian, a picnic in Iran, cream teas in Kosovo.

To achieve this, we'll be covering 6000 miles through 20 countries in an astonishingly brown Rover 2200TC.

Route: England, France, Germany, Poland, Ukraine, Romania, Turkey, Georgia, Azerbaijan, Iran, Syria, Bulgaria, Serbia, Kosova, Albania, Bosnia and Herzegovina, Croatia, Slovenia, Italy, Switzerland, France, England.

Kick off is on July 21st 2008. Follow our progress at www.practicalclassics.co.uk and www.slightlycliveracing.com

The trip will form the basis of a major feature in Practical Classics magazine, so publicity potential for sponsors abounds. A donation of £25 will secure one square foot of advertising space on the CliveRover's shapely exterior, including sticker printing costs.
